NewsOnline digital photo sharing market : Avanquest Software, announced its entry into the online digital photo sharing market with the acquisition of the assets of Boulder, Colorado-based SendPhotos, developer of SendPhotos. Avanquest, which markets software products through retail, reseller and OEM channels in America, Europe and Asia, said the advanced online photo sharing site and photo sharing technologies acquired in the transaction will be used to expand its range of consumer and business product offerings. “This investment brings one of the most powerful and fully-featured photo management solutions available to consumers under the Avanquest umbrella,” said Bob Lang, president, Avanquest Software USA.

Bob Lang added: “The SendPhotos platform will support the activities of our consumer publishing and OEM divisions to build a strong position in the global digital imaging marketplace by offering a wide range of valuable solutions to our customers.” The first Avanquest solution to leverage the SendPhotos technology and SendPhotos portal is SendPhotos Mobile, Avanquest’s entry in the dynamic Mobile Value Added Service (MVAS) market. The end-to-end solution for deployment by wireless carriers will be demonstrated for the first time in North America by Avanquest’s OEM division at CTIA Wireless 2007 in Orlando, March 26-29. A complete value-added service that can drive 3G network utilization to boost ARPU and increase operator sales of higher resolution camera phones, SendPhotos Mobile uses patented device memory management technology to automate image uploads, eliminating user concerns about device memory limits and ensuring against loss of precious images.

Operators can deploy the Avanquest client software using any existing photo management portal or SendPhotos, which tightly integrates with the new operator-customizable client. Generating recurring revenue to operators through photo back-up subscriptions and increased data charges, the solution also helps lower camera phone costs to consumers through reduced internal device memory requirements, extending the availability of higher resolution cameras phones in the marketplace. Financial terms of the SendPhotos Mobile transaction were not disclosed. Employees of SendPhotos, Inc. have been integrated into Avanquest’s Westminster, Colorado operations.

SendPhotos 5GB online photo storage - Features
SendPhotos provides users with 5 GB of online photo storage and a software tool that offers the easiest form of photo sharing and greatly expanded creative possibilities. The site’s 30,000 current subscribers enjoy unique features that enable them to:
• Give rights to friends to add pictures to one or more personal online collections.
• Create photo stories with colorful designs and the user’s own personal captions.
• Synchronize PC and online folders so users never lose pictures.
• Utilize easy email transfer - eliminating cumbersome attachments and slow downloads

About Avanquest Software
Avanquest Software is a leading developer and global publisher of best-selling personal and professional software designed for utilities, office productivity, communications and mobility worldwide. Headquartered in France, with operating units, subsidiaries and offices located in United States, France, Germany, Great Britain, Italy, Spain, China and Korea, Avanquest Software products are marketed in over 100 countries, through e-commerce, OEM partnerships and IT resellers. Founded in 1984 as BVRP Software and listed since December 1996 on Euronext, Avanquest Software forms part of the Eurolist, NextEconomy segment and SBF 250 index.
